This one was captured at abandoned airfield (aviation school) in Volchansk - 75km from my city. After Soviet Union collapse in 1991 this airfield has been closed, lots of aircraft stood there under open and guarded by few militaries. In 2013 all guards gone, and locals starts to disassemble aircraft. Now, there only naked fuselages left, a couple of helicopters remains one engine. Lots of L29 airplanes, An-2, Mi-2 helicopters. This place nowadays becomes some kind of museum. Hundreds of people visits it on holidays. I took around 2000 photos of helicopter, 1867 was good. Nikon d5300, 18-55mm@18mm kit, 1/160 s, f/8, ISO-125. It appears, that lots of photos are blurred, so I deleted them, but I still unsatisfied with remaining photos. I had no time to visit this place again to make good photos, so I left it as is.
